Jennifer Lopez releases the Lil Wayne version of her “I’m Into You” music video. The Lil Wayne cameo was filmed in Los Angeles because his probation rules prevented him from flying to Mexico, where Lopez shot her version on a beach with Cuban model and actor William Levy. “I’m Into You” is taken from Jennifer Lopez’s new studio album “Love?” which has been in stores across the US since May 3rd.
